官术网_书友最值得收藏!

Introduction to Ansible Playbooks and Roles

According to Wikipedia, Ansible is an open source automation engine that automates software provisioning, configuration management, and application deployment. But you already knew that. This book is about taking the idea of IT automation software and applying it to the domain of Information Security Automation. 

The book will take you through the journey of security automation to show how Ansible is used in the real world. 

In this book, we will be automating security-related tasks in a structured, modular fashion using a simple human-readable format YAML. Most importantly, what you will learn to create will be repeatable. This means once it is done, you can focus on fine-tuning, expanding the scope, and so on. The tool ensures that we can build and tear down anything, from simple application stacks to simple, but extensive, multi-application frameworks working together. 

If you have been playing around with Ansible, and in this book we assume you have, you would have definitely come across some of the following terms:

  • Playbook
  • Ansible Modules 
  • YAML
  • Roles
  • Templates (Jinja2)

Don't worry, we will address all of the aforementioned terms in this chapter. Once you are comfortable with these topics, we will move on to covering scheduler tools, and then to building security automation playbooks. 

主站蜘蛛池模板: 芦溪县| 吉首市| 德令哈市| 图片| 平昌县| 靖西县| 宁阳县| 房产| 陆丰市| 中阳县| 宜宾市| 沂南县| 长顺县| 汉川市| 大城县| 岑巩县| 宁波市| 陆良县| 余干县| 安康市| 昌乐县| 岗巴县| 额济纳旗| 太康县| 西乡县| 建平县| 宣武区| 靖宇县| 石狮市| 成都市| 德钦县| 博白县| 喀什市| 永顺县| 界首市| 沅陵县| 上饶县| 通辽市| 屏东市| 延川县| 怀集县|